Lenin Centenary: Wherever Ideas Lead Us, We Follow, By Owei Lakemfa

It has turned out so far, to be the only centenary conference marking the passage of Vladimir Lenin, the first person to lead a socialist revolution. The other activity was in Moscow where flowers were laid in his mausoleum.   In Abuja, Nigeria, over 300 of us from Nigeria, United States, Cuba, Ghana, South Africa, Venezuela, Palestine, Russia and United Kingdom met physically for two days from January 22-23, 2024 to mark the January 21, 1924 exit of Lenin. We were joined virtually by people from various countries, especially in Europe.   ....

Khana warns AI could 'erode' workers' rights, pay

Rep. Ro Khanna (D-Calif.) warned about the risks the rise of artificial intelligence (AI) could have on the working class and called for federal policy that would give workers power over decisions about AI in an op-ed published Thursday in The New York Times. Khanna, who represents a district that includes Silicon Valley, wrote… ....
